Our mission as Arab Baptist Theological Seminary is to serve the Church in our region as it realizes its Biblical mission of having Christ acknowledged as Lord by offering specialized learning resources and equipping faithful men and women for effective service. Alongside our on-campus courses, the Arab Baptist Theological Seminary's Institute of Middle East Studies (IMES) seeks to increase general awareness about Middle East realities. IMES' mandate is to bring about positive transformation in thinking and practice between inter-faith groups in Lebanon and beyond. Effective Fall 2012, IMES will be offering a Master of Religion in Middle Eastern and North African Studies. Whether a gift to Arab Baptist Theological Seminary (ABTS) lowers your own taxes depends on where you pay them. Choose your country to see the rule that applies.
Donations may be tax-deductible for residents of Lebanon under local rules. Confirm with the charity directly.
Arab Baptist Theological Seminary is listed in Lebanon. Donations from the Netherlands to charities outside the EU/EEA are generally not tax-deductible for Dutch donors unless the charity is listed on the Dutch ANBI register with foreign-recognized status.
Arab Baptist Theological Seminary is listed in Lebanon. US donors generally cannot deduct gifts to non-US charities directly. To claim a deduction, route the gift through a US 'Friends of' fiscal sponsor or a donor-advised fund that performs equivalency determination (IRS Rev. Proc. 92-94).
This is general guidance, not tax advice. Confirm treatment with the charity or your tax advisor before donating.
